Hello! As promised I am back with the second instalment of my Penny Black Timeless inspiration posts.

Today I have used a cute and adorable bear stamp called Irish Luck. I decided to change things up a bit though, as I didn’t need a good luck card in my stash. So in order to cover up the four-leaf clovers, I used a small flower image from an older Penny Black set called ...So Loved.

I was not sure about a sentiment, so I ended leaving it off. I can always add one later if need be.

I stamped and coloured him with Copic markers (I really should try a different medium, but Copics are just my all-time favourite medium to use – and I have to go with what works right?)

Supplies

Stamps: Penny Black Irish Luck and …So Loved stamp sets Card:  Neenah Solar White card stock Ink: VersaFine ink, Memento Tuxedo Black ink Other Supplies: Copic Markers (Bear: E13, E25, E27, E31, E34, E47, E49, Jacket: R05, R14, R29, R39, Flowers/Hat bandL YR68, Y19, Grass: YG03, YG17, YG67, Hat: C1, C3, C4, C6, C7, C9) 3D mounting foam, Nuvo Crystal drops Ivory Seashell
